  3. Rust Craft Greeting Card Company -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Rust_Craft_Greeting_Card...

    Rust revolutionized the use of the "French Fold," which turned a single piece of paper into a card by folding it into quarters. [1] [2] They were the first company to sell greeting cards with a fitted envelope. [3] Rust was soon joined by his brother Donald. [1] Fred then began to focus more on the creative and sales aspects of the company ...
